Study Links Hormone-Disrupting Chemicals to Skin Condition
Research conducted by Johns Hopkins Medicine has revealed a potential link between hormone-disrupting chemicals found in plastics and a chronic inflammatory skin condition known as hidradenitis suppurativa (HS). This study, involving a small sample of twelve participants, is believed to be the first to indicate that these chemicals may exacerbate or even contribute to the development of HS, which primarily affects skin folds.
The findings, published in March 2024, highlight the presence of these endocrine-disrupting substances in common products, including ultra-processed foods and single-use water bottles. This connection raises significant concerns about the impact of everyday items on health, particularly for individuals already suffering from conditions like HS.
Hidradenitis suppurativa is characterized by painful lumps and abscesses that can lead to scarring and severe discomfort. For those affected, managing the disease is complex and often requires comprehensive treatment plans. The insights from this research suggest that environmental factors, particularly exposure to certain chemicals, may play a crucial role in the severity of symptoms.
Participants in the study were assessed for their exposure to specific hormone-disrupting chemicals. The results indicated a correlation between higher levels of these substances and increased disease activity among participants. The researchers emphasized the need for further investigation into how these chemicals interact with the human body and contribute to inflammatory processes.
